Sodium Fluoride Dosing for Otosclerosis
For patients with otosclerosis experiencing progressive sensorineural hearing loss, sodium fluoride should be prescribed at doses ranging from 20-60 mg daily (typically 40-60 mg/day), combined with calcium supplementation (400-800 mg/day) and vitamin D, though the evidence supporting this practice is weak and conflicting. 1, 2, 3
Clinical Context and Evidence Quality
The use of sodium fluoride in otosclerosis represents a treatment with limited high-quality evidence. Only one double-blind, placebo-controlled trial showed benefit, reporting an 18% absolute risk reduction in hearing deterioration after 2 years of treatment 4. However, another placebo-controlled study found no clinically significant difference between sodium fluoride and placebo groups 4. This conflicting evidence means any recommendation must be made cautiously.
Dosing Regimen
Standard Treatment Protocol
- Sodium fluoride dose: 40-60 mg daily (some protocols use 20 mg twice daily) 1, 2
- Calcium supplementation: 400-800 mg daily (essential to prevent gastric side effects and support bone metabolism) 1
- Vitamin D: Should be added to enhance calcium absorption 5
- Duration: Long-term therapy (typically years), though optimal duration is not established 3
Patient Selection Criteria
Sodium fluoride therapy is most likely to benefit patients with:
- Rapidly progressive hearing loss (≥5 dB/year at speech frequencies) - these patients showed 79% response rates in case series 2
- Active otospongiotic disease (documented progressive sensorineural hearing loss) 2
- Cochlear otosclerosis (63% showed halted/slowed progression) or stapedial otosclerosis with sensorineural component (46% response rate) 2
Safety Considerations and Monitoring
Contraindications and Precautions
Do not use sodium fluoride in:
- Pregnancy (teratogenic in animal studies, though human data limited) 6
- Patients with renal insufficiency (reduced fluoride clearance increases toxicity risk) 6, 7
- Children with developing teeth (risk of dental fluorosis) 8
Toxicity Thresholds
- Safe upper limit: 4 mg/day for men, 3 mg/day for women for nutritional purposes 6
- Therapeutic doses for otosclerosis (40-60 mg/day) are 10-20 times higher than safe nutritional limits 1
- Serum toxicity threshold: >50 μg/L 6, 7
- Urinary toxicity threshold: >10 mg/24 hours 6
Required Monitoring

During treatment:
- Monitor for gastric complaints, anemia, bone pain, neuromuscular symptoms 6, 8
- Serial audiometry every 6-12 months to assess treatment response 1, 2
- Consider periodic serum fluoride levels (therapeutic levels are 5-10 times normal reference values) 6
Common Adverse Effects
- Gastric symptoms (most common - minimized by calcium co-administration) 1
- Chronic toxicity manifestations: gastric complaints, anemia, osteomalacia, neuromuscular symptoms 6, 8
- Cardiac complications (observed in chronic high-dose exposure) 6
Clinical Decision Algorithm
Step 1: Document progressive sensorineural hearing loss with serial audiograms
- If progression ≥5 dB/year at speech frequencies → strong candidate 2
- If stable hearing → sodium fluoride not indicated 2
Step 2: Exclude contraindications
- Check renal function, pregnancy status 6, 7
- Assess baseline fluoride exposure (water supply, tea consumption) 6
Step 3: Initiate therapy if appropriate
- Start sodium fluoride 40-60 mg daily with calcium 400-800 mg and vitamin D 1
- Counsel on gastric side effects and need for long-term compliance 1
Step 4: Monitor response
- Repeat audiometry at 6-12 month intervals 1, 2
- Continue if hearing stabilizes or improves 2
- Consider discontinuation if progression continues despite 1-2 years of therapy 3
Important Caveats
The evidence base is weak: Only one positive placebo-controlled trial exists, with another showing no benefit 4. Most supporting data comes from uncontrolled case series from the 1980s 1, 2. The 2014 systematic review concluded there is "weak evidence from one study with significant limitations" 4.
Alternative management: Bisphosphonates can be considered as an alternative in patients intolerant to sodium fluoride, though evidence is even more limited 5. Hearing aids remain a valid option that doesn't carry systemic toxicity risks 5.
Vestibular symptoms: Some evidence suggests sodium fluoride may reduce dizziness associated with otosclerosis, though this is a secondary benefit 5.
Given the weak evidence and potential for toxicity at therapeutic doses, shared decision-making is essential, weighing the limited evidence of benefit against the need for long-term high-dose fluoride exposure with its attendant risks. 3, 4
